Materials

One of the reasons to have a Wilson Hyper Hammer 5.3 review is its material. The brand has chosen the best one for its frame that is with Carbon fiber. This material comprises of carbon threads braided to form a kind of mat shaped into mold using head and pressure. It’s a polymer-based material that combines several yarns of carbon to offer resistant quality.

Carbon fiber is such a material that offers an amazing strength to weight ratio. Not only that, it also belongs to the stiffer material and can provide you with wonderful kinetic energy transfer. To add more, this material is also stated to be lightweight as well as durable.

While the material of the frame leaves you stunned, the string material makes you feel completely opposite. The strings are made of polyester and has been stated to be very low of quality as per the users.

Not only the users faced trouble with ripping apart of the strings, but also with their inappropriate tension. As a result, you may not feel comfortable with the strings used in the racquet.

Moreover, it has also been stated to vibrate a lot, and the reason is again the strings.

That said, the racquet features open string pattern. And that will provide you with spin and power which is a big plus.

 

Weight

Hyper Hammer 5.3 comes pre-strung and weighs around 254 gram. Even with the strings on, you will find the racquet to be lighter than many of the rivals.

Since, it’s a lighter racquet, it is stated to be great for adult players who are new to the tennis sport. Coming in such weight would mean, coming with ease of maneuverability.

Plus, you will also be able to play with it for a longer period as it will not cause any fatigue and pain in your wrists and forearms.

The big plus is that, it also will give you comfort that has delighted many players.

 

Size and Length

Wilson Hyper Hammer 5.3 has been designed with an oversized head. It features an 110 square inches sized head meaning the sweet spot will be larger and you will have lesser chance to mishit the ball.

Oversized head has a lot of perks. It can let you strike the ball effectively by producing a greater power and forgiveness with its bigger sweet spot.

Albeit, you may find it hard to control the head with ease, but that should not be an issue. It’s because, the more you will get the play with it, the more control you can enjoy.

Moreover, the racquet has a length of 27.5 inches. As it is more of a longer sized racquet, you can enjoy more power and reach.

 

Head Balance

The brand has designed the Hyper Hammer with head heavy balance. If you love to play rigorous game, then head heavy racquet will be great for you.

Head heavy means, the weight is given more to the head than the shaft. So, it will help amplify power of your smashes and you can enjoy the game evidently. Not only that, such feature can also provide you with consistent clears.

Plus, it also helps increase momentum and stability in its lightweight frame.

Grip and Its Size

As for the grip of the racquet, it definitely feels great. You can hold the shaft firmly and your sweaty hands will not cause slippage.

You will find about 4 options for the grip size. Out of the 4, this one comes in 4.5 inches which is the US size.

The grip size is a very technical feature and the size of your hand plays a big role. If you have mid-sized hands, then it will be a perfect pick.

However, it does not mean that players with small and big sized hands won’t be able to play with it. You can modify the size by adding or removing grip tape layer. So, this is not really a big on we would say.

The only thing you need to keep in mind is to try it out before making a purchase. Do check if it delivers full range of motion in your wrists and forearms.

 

About Wilson

The Wilson Sporting Goods Company (WSGC) had been founded by Thomas E Wilson in 1913 which is about 106 years back. It was initiated as Ashland Manufacturing Company that later changed to WSGC. Since 1989, the company is stated to merge with Bogey Acquisitions Company while becoming a subsidiary of the Finnish group Amer Sports.

It is an American-based company located in Chicago, Illinois and manufactures sports equipment especially sports such as tennis, squash, soccer, racquetball, golf, fastpitch softball, basketball, baseball, badminton, football and volleyball.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Q: What is an Open string pattern?

A: An open string pattern is designed with fewer strings. So there will be more gaps between them. Such pattern helps in putting a spin on the ball. It’s because dense strings are more likely to bite into the ball easily. However, spin generation yet counts more on your technique, so if you do not use a top-spin form, it can be a moot point. Moreover, since the strings will be fewer in number to absorb the ball impact, hard hitters may face the strings ripping apart pretty quicker.

Q: Does the racquet have vibration dampening technology?

A: No, the racquet does not particularly have vibration dampening technology. So, it is likely to vibrate while you strike the ball. However, the racquet comes with a piece of rubber placed in between 2 middle vertical strings below the horizontal ones. If you don’t want it to vibrate, you can add a vibration dampener to the racquet separately.

Q: Does the racquet come strung and will you get a cover with it?

A: Yes, the Wilson Hyper Hammer 5.3 racquet comes pre-strung and no, it does not come with a cover.

Q: Is it a male or female racquet? Can intermediate players use it?

A:  The Wilson Hyper Hammer 5.3 is a unisex racquet. It has been designed for both male and female players. Not only that, it is also stated to be great for both beginners and intermediate players as well. So yes the latter can use it with ease. The racquet is very light, forgiving and responsive, so you will love to practice the game for longer-term with effective shots.

Q: What is the string tension and what string should you use for the racquet?

A: The racquet comes pre-strung at about 60 pounds tension. The sticker on the body recommends to use Wilson NXT String.
